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43 89494840591 12418711 699 010722
96 329578596
96 329578596
68120 863 492575
All about undefined
Interested in learning more?
96 329578596
68120 863 492575
See more
460764 3351
219033 2715493 4073
See more
3261 9646357971
258 924 20575 2659177
See more